Advertisement

微信小程序的设计与开发工作,涉及垃圾分类。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文详细阐述了利用深度学习技术对垃圾进行分类的方案,并探讨了将训练好的学习模型部署到微信小程序平台,从而切实提升居民日常生活的便利性。该项目的设计核心包含两个主要部分:首先,通过Python编程语言结合深度神经网络算法,构建一套高效的图像识别系统,并通过模型训练过程获得性能最优的模型;其次,借助微信开发工具搭建垃圾分类微信小程序,并充分利用先前训练得到的模型来完成整个垃圾分类系统的全面设计与开发工作。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.zip
    优质
    这是一个方便实用的微信小程序,旨在帮助用户更好地理解和参与垃圾分类。通过它,您可以轻松查询各类垃圾的分类方法,学习环保知识,并获得积分奖励以鼓励持续参与。 该微信小程序主要用于垃圾分类,并实现了以下功能:1. 文字搜索:用户可以通过输入文本来查找相应的垃圾分类;2. 拍照识别:通过拍摄图片并自动识别其中的文本,然后进行垃圾分类查询;3. 语音识别:将用户的语音转化为文字后,再根据转化后的文字查询对应的垃圾分类信息;4. 垃圾分类基础数据展示:小程序中的数据分为四大类,并且每一大类的数据都可以按照字母表顺序索引查找。
  • 源码
    优质
    这款垃圾分类微信小程序源码旨在帮助用户便捷地进行垃圾投放分类。通过输入或拍照识别垃圾种类,提供准确详细的分类指南,助力环保行动。 垃圾分类小程序实现介绍:小程序使用了百度AI的图片识别和语音识别接口,需要自行到百度平台申请,并用对应的key替换。请在cloudfunctions-baiduAccessToken-index.js文件中将apiKey和secretKey替换成自己的百度AI上的接口信息。 代码示例如下: ```javascript let apiKey = 你的百度ai接口的apiKey, secretKey = 你的secretKey, url = `https://aip.baidubce.com/oauth/2.0/token`; ``` 小程序中还使用了云开发功能,具体介绍请参考微信官方文档。初始化云开发后,请在app.js文件中的env值替换为自己的云开发环境id。 示例代码如下: ```javascript wx.cloud.init({ env: 你的云开发环境id, }); ```
  • 有关
    优质
    这是一款致力于推动垃圾分类普及与实践的微信小程序。用户可以通过该程序学习垃圾分类知识、查询垃圾类别,并参与互动活动,共同建设绿色家园。 关于垃圾分类的简单小程序适用于初次学习微信小程序的人参考练手。该程序包含首页、再生产和分类三大模块:首页介绍了一些有关垃圾分类的基本知识;再生产部分通过tab切换列表展示了垃圾变废为宝的相关内容,包括如何回收利用的图文教程;分类模块则详细介绍了各种垃圾分类,并提供了搜索特定类型垃圾的二级页面功能。整个小程序界面美观大方。 这是本人初学微信小程序时制作的一个小示例程序。
  • 答题源码.zip
    优质
    这是一个基于微信平台的垃圾分类答题小程序的源代码压缩包。它利用了云端结合的技术方案进行快速部署和开发,旨在提高公众对垃圾分类知识的认知与实践能力。 这款垃圾分类答题云开发微信小程序集成了多种功能,包括文字识别、语音识别、图片识别以及附近垃圾场定位,并且还配备了腾讯机器人的智能问询服务。用户可以通过该程序进行垃圾分类的学习与实践,同时参与相关的知识问答活动以加深对垃圾分类的认识和理解。
  • 源码.zip
    优质
    本项目为一款实用的垃圾分类指导微信小程序源代码。用户可以通过输入或上传图片来识别垃圾类别,并获取详细的分类指南和环保知识,旨在提高公众的环保意识和参与度。 微信小程序垃圾分类源码提供了一个高分项目(90分以上),代码由个人亲手编写,并配有详细的注释,适合用作课程设计或大作业参考。该小程序具备文字输入及拍照识别功能,非常适合学习使用。
  • 源码.zip
    优质
    这段代码是用于创建一个微信小程序,旨在帮助用户更好地进行垃圾分类。它包含了一系列功能,如垃圾类型识别、分类指南查询等,有助于提高公众环保意识和参与度。 微信小程序—垃圾分类小程序源码.zip
  • SSM(版).rar
    优质
    这款名为“垃圾分类小程序SSM”的微信应用致力于提供便捷高效的垃圾分类指南服务,帮助用户快速准确地识别和处理各类垃圾,促进环保行动。 在当今社会,垃圾分类已经成为一项重要的环保措施,并且信息技术的应用显著推动了这一进程的普及与效率提升。本段落将探讨一款名为“weixin243垃圾分类小程序ssm”的项目,该项目基于Java语言及Spring Boot框架开发,主要功能是实现垃圾分类查询和管理。 项目名称中的“weixin”表明该程序可能与微信平台相关联,意味着它很可能是一款微信小程序。这种应用无需下载安装即可使用,并且用户只需扫一扫或搜索一下就能打开应用,非常适合需要随时随地访问的轻量级服务如垃圾分类查询。 Java作为一种成熟的编程语言,在企业级开发中被广泛采用,其稳定性和跨平台特性使得基于它的应用程序具有良好的扩展和维护能力。Spring Boot框架则是建立在Spring之上的一个简化新项目搭建与开发流程的工具,它通过“约定优于配置”的原则大大提升了开发者的工作效率。 该项目已经过严格的测试验证以确保程序能够稳定运行,并且源码开放促进了社区内的学习交流以及项目的持续改进和发展。 从资源文件来看,此项目采用了前后端分离架构。前端部分使用了诸如colorui这样的UI框架来快速构建美观的用户界面;同时包含了大量CSS样式表用于页面设计和布局优化,以提升用户体验。在后端方面,则有“3-build.bat”、“2-run.bat”以及“1-install.bat”等批处理文件支持项目的自动部署与维护。 项目标签中提及了“winxin”,这可能是对微信小程序的另一种拼写形式;而明确列出的技术栈包括Java和Spring Boot,确保了该项目能够高效响应用户需求,并在高并发场景下保持性能稳定。 综上所述,“weixin243垃圾分类小程序ssm”结合现代信息技术与环保理念,通过便捷的小程序访问方式、强大的后端支持以及精心设计的前端界面为用户提供了一套高效的垃圾分类查询和管理解决方案。该项目因其开源性质及非商业用途而成为了一个优秀的学习案例。
  • 基于源代码.zip
    优质
    这是一个基于微信云开发环境设计的垃圾分类小程序源代码包。该程序旨在帮助用户便捷地进行生活垃圾分类投放,促进环保理念普及。 微信云开发是由微信团队提供的后端服务解决方案,为开发者提供了一站式的数据库、存储、云函数等服务支持,使得无需搭建服务器环境就能进行高效的后端开发工作。基于此技术的垃圾分类小程序源码旨在帮助用户识别并分类垃圾。 理解小程序的开发流程是关键步骤之一:这是一种在微信内部运行的应用形式,不需要下载安装即可使用。其开发涉及前端界面设计、交互逻辑编写和后台数据处理等多个方面,在这个项目中主要是通过微信开发者工具结合WXML(微信小程序标记语言)和WXSS(微信小程序样式语言)来构建用户界面,并利用JavaScript处理页面的业务逻辑。 在这款基于微信云开发的产品里,主要功能包括: 1. **云数据库**:这是一种NoSQL类型的数据库,支持JSON格式的数据存储方式。开发者可以用来保存垃圾分类相关的各种信息。 2. **云存储**:此服务允许上传和管理多媒体文件(如图片、音频及视频),满足小程序中展示各类垃圾图像的需求。 3. **云函数**:用于编写后端逻辑的平台,无需考虑服务器运维问题。例如,在用户上传垃圾图片时,可以通过调用API来自动识别其类型。 4. **身份验证机制**:确保只有合法的小程序能够访问云端资源,从而保障应用的安全性。 5. **实时推送功能**:可以实现消息通知等功能,如更新垃圾分类规则或提醒处理垃圾。 在这个源码项目中,“refuse-classification-master”可能是项目的主目录名称,其中包括了小程序的各个组成部分。通过研究这个开源代码库,开发者不仅可以学习到如何配置云环境、与数据库进行交互以及使用云函数等技能,还能了解如何实现具体的业务逻辑和优化用户体验的设计思路。 总之,这是一个非常实用的小程序应用案例,并且是微信小程序开发及微信云端服务的一个优秀教学资源。通过对源码的研究分析,可以提升个人的技术水平并将其应用于其他类似项目中去。
  • 基于平台实现.docx
    优质
    本文档探讨并实施了一款基于微信平台的垃圾分类小程序的设计方案,旨在通过便捷的技术手段提高公众对垃圾分类的认知和参与度。 本段落提出了一种利用深度学习方法进行垃圾分类的方案,并将该模型集成到微信小程序中以方便居民使用。该项目主要分为两个部分:首先,基于Python开发了一个图像识别算法,通过训练得到了理想的分类模型;其次,在微信平台上构建了用于垃圾智能分类的小程序,并集成了上述训练出的模型来实现整个系统的功能设计与开发。
  • 基于实现系统.doc
    优质
    本文档介绍了一款基于微信小程序开发的垃圾分类辅助工具的设计与实现过程,旨在通过便捷的技术手段提升公众参与垃圾分类的积极性和准确性。 第一章 绪论 第二章 相关技术介绍 第三章 需求分析 3.1 可行性分析 3.1.1 经济可行性 3.1.2 技术可行性 3.2 解决重点问题分析 3.3 系统功能需求 3.4 业务流程分析 3.5 系统用例图 3.6 数据流程图 3.7 数据字典 第四章 系统总体设计 4.1 结构功能设计 4.2 系统总体结构图 4.2.1 总体结构图 4.2.2 后端结构图 4.3 系统数据库设计 4.3.1 系统E-R实体图设计 4.3.2 数据库逻辑结构设计 第五章 系统功能实现 5.1 微信主界面功能实现 5.2 文字搜索功能实现 5.3 拍照识别功能实现 5.4 课堂功能实现 5.5 帮助功能实现 5.6 答题功能实现 第六章 系统测试 6.1 测试目的 6.2 系统测试的范围 6.3 测试方法 6.4 系统的功能测试 6.5 测试结果分析 第七章 结束语 参考文献 致谢 附录